COFFEE, DECAFFEINATED



SPECIFICATIONS

COFFEE, DECAFFEINATED

OVERVIEW

This contract will cover the requirements of Coffee via “Push Button” or “lever” machine for the Department of Human Services (DHS) / Danville State Hospital (DSH).

TERM OF CONTRACT

Anticipated Term of Contract: 01/01/18 (or upon full execution of contract; whichever is later) through 12/31/18

METHOD OF AWARD

The Commonwealth will award by lowest priced bid by a responsive and responsible bidder meeting the minimum qualifications/requirements set forth in this IFB.

Vendor must arrange a site visit and complete the attached site visit form to be considered responsive.

PRODUCT SPECIFICATIONS/REQUIREMENTS

An estimated quantity of 5 cases of Regular and 12 cases of decaffeinated each month for 12 months equaling a total of 204 cases is based on the following pack size: 2-2 liters or 4-1 liters/case mix ratio 35/1=39 gal/case (if vendor bidding different pack size or type of coffee being offered adjust to overall bid amounts/volume requested). Award will be made on cost per finished ounce of each type.

Dietary will call to arrange delivery date and amount needed each month in the event monthly case amount needs to be modified.

Delivery is to be made to the Dietary Dock.

100% pure coffee, Columbian and/or Arabica blend, decaffeinated AND caffeinated, Maxwell House brand or equivalent. Caffeine content: 97% caffeine-free if decaffeinated.

Product may be ‘bag in box’, closed type concentrated product/system, refrigerated/frozen only.

FREEZE-DRIED PRODUCT IS NOT ACCEPTABLE.

Shelf life: Refrigerated or thawed - 3 weeks

Frozen - 1 year.

If bidding differently, vendor to state ‘mix ratio’ to qualify cups per case of finished product. Mix ratio is: _________

EQUIPMENT SPECIFICATIONS/REQUIREMENTS

Product must meet the ‘push button’ or ‘lever’ machine dispensed specifications as outlined. Machine may not be dispensed in an open tap/non-portioned control flow.

Vendor shall supply water filters.

Successful bidder to furnish, install, and maintain at no additional cost to the buyer, all dispensing equipment as specified in bid during the term of this contract, to reconstitute the coffee at a mixing ratio and temperature to be determined by the Dietary Services. Equipment shall remain the property of the vendor and shall be returned at the end of the contract period when all purchased product is used. Vendor shall make arrangements and handle the return/pick-up of all equipment.

If machine and equipment are not picked up within 3 months following termination of contract and supply, hospital reserves the right to dispose of equipment.

Dispensing Equipment shall have: Metered portioned and continuous dispensing control; hot water dispensing available for alternate beverages, cleaning brushes, flex hose, and unit accessories as necessary. Locking capability for outside of unit. UL listed and N.S.F. approved.

Quantity of Dispensers requested: Two (2) each - Tray Service

Similar to Model Aromat Powerplex D4 or equivalent.

Style of Operation: portioned and continuous flow control, dispensing up to 180 degrees and as low as 160 degrees F.

Dispensing Style: Push button/lever/Portion Control, and Continuous Flow or level control.

INSTALLATION OF EQUIPMENT

Installation of dispensing equipment shall be arranged with the Dietary Services in advance of the contract period. Buyer shall provide utility connections above floor level and within six (6) feet of site location(s).

SERVICE: 24 hour, seven day emergency service shall be provided on all dispensing equipment, as well as a required preventative maintenance program, service checks, with reports:

Reports to begin:

- 1 at set-up and installation

-A preventative maintenance program service check report every two months thereafter, submitted to the Director of Dietary Services for file with Clerk Typist copy of contract

-Additional service reports for any emergency service calls in between and above required visits, to ensure the system is working properly.

**Note: Lack of required documentation will be cause for termination of this contract.

TRAINING: Vendor shall provide training on the operation and daily cleaning required for dispensing equipment to ensure uninterrupted coffee service.

CANCELLATION CLAUSE: Quantities listed are estimates only and may be increased or decreased in accordance with the actual requirements of the facility. With notification ten calendar days prior to delivery, the facility reserves the right to cancel any quantity for the order and agrees to pay the vendor only for products actually accepted by the department.

Vendor to specify brand, package size, mix ratio, cost, machine being supplied at time of bid.

NOTE: Dispensing machine shall be as listed below, or an approved equal that meets all the above metered portion controlled dispensing and other features as specified above:

Electrical/Water Specs:

208-240V AC Single Phase

30 AMP Circuit

3/8” or ½ “ water line as appropriate to location
